6 Intro to Settlement Most cases settle –Roughly 2/3rds of filed cases settle Some cases settle even before complaint filed –Roughly 5% go to trial –Roughly 20% dismissed (Rule 12) or terminated by summary judgment –Roughly 10% other – default judgment, plaintiff failed to prosecute, referred to arbitration, etc. Settlement is contract by which plaintiff dismisses case in return for something valuable from the defendant –Usually money –Can be almost anything – job, house, letter of recommendation, apology –Often non-monetary terms -- Confidentiality/secrecy, return of discovery documents, payment of costs Economic analysis of settlement –Settlement is attractive to parties because it enables them to save on the cost of litigation –Settlements is sometimes not possible, because parties are sometimes too optimistic about trial outcomes –Settlement is sometimes not reached, if the parties are too stubborn (strategic) in their negotiations 6

7 Intro ADR ADR = Alternative Disputes Resolution –Mediation. Settlement negotiations with assistance from neutral person Mediator does not have power to imposed settlement Used with increasing frequency –Arbitration. Adjudication by private judge –Settlement is sometimes classified as ADR 7
